Position: Ticket Operations Associate

Department: Ticket Operations

Status: Match Day (Part-Time/Non-Exempt)


Primary Responsibilities

  • Help in all areas of the Event Day Ticket Operations from the beginning of the day to the end of the event for all events at Bank of America Stadium. Shifts range from 3 to 12 hours on event days.
  • Assist in the event day operation of the Tepper Sports & Entertainment Ticket Office through:
    • Gate Manager: Assist Ticket Takers at the gates, answers questions for Ticket Takers and directs patrons if needed as an extension of the Main Ticket Office.
    • Will Call: Distribute Will Call properly and accurately to assure quality customer service.
    • Answering Phones: Assist with answering phones and customers' questions.
    • TicketMaster Sales: Learn to use the TicketMaster system for selling single game tickets.
    • Customer Service: Perform any customer service functions as needed.
    • Runners - as needed: May be needed to navigate around the stadium in order to perform duties.
  • Develop an understanding for a very fast-paced Event Day Ticket Office.
  • Other duties as assigned.
